Julz,
The board is a completely easy cheesy. Angulo Nui. 11'9 x 31". It's like standing on your kitchen table and going for a paddle. It's a bit of a pig until you get it on a wave (or a bump on a downwind run), but it's still a super fun, family friendly board. Kinda surfs, kinda runs downwind, kinda cheaper than buying a quiver of boards...
